Ohio is a rather difficult state to deal with for liquor and it is very hard and sometimes impossible to get your hands on a whisky you want.
Thanks to Mark coming through with the choppers, the state finally saw fit to "allow" a case of the Corryvreckan and Supernova into my store.
(pre-event we were denied without the entire case being pre-sold)
I for one owe Ardbeg and the Ardbeg Chopper tour a great big thanks.
Without them, I would not have a bottle of the Corryvreckan on my shelf right now.
Caol Ila is my all time fave Islay, but this Corryvreckan may convert me back to Ardbeg?
I really like the way your first drink hits you with a
BIG sod of peat and fires through your nose like a hit of wasabi!
Then the second drink is very different. And again for the third.
Really complex and every ounce is a long and rewarding experience.
